Chester Castle


 

Chester Castle was built in 1069 by William the Conqueror in Chester, Cheshire. It was besieged during the English Civil War.

It was rebuilt as a prison over a 37-year period from the 1790s to a design by Thomas Harrison, later County Surveyor of Cheshire.
